Joyce vance health problems. About. Joyce Vance. Joyce White Vance is a Distinguished Professor of the Practice of Law at Hugh F. Culverhouse Jr. School of Law at The University of Alabama. She served as the U.S. Attorney for the Northern District of Alabama from 2009 to 2017. She was nominated for that position by President Barack Obama in May of 2009 and unanimously ...

July 7, 2023. Author and Bible teacher Joyce Meyer has had several significant health problems recently, but shared last week on her social media that she is on the mend. In a video posted Thursday, June 29, Meyer said that she took a fall and has been in a wheelchair. Joyce Vance (October 26, 1946 - February 1, 2010) Funeral services for Joyce Vance, 63, of Salina will be held Friday, February 5 at 2:00 PM at First Baptist Church in Pryor. Dr. Michael Cox will officiate with burial following at Graham Memorial Cemetery in Pryor.
